Membership support

ISRV is a not-for-profit organisation. Income received through membership subscriptions, event registration fees, sponsors and funders is used to support respiratory disease scientists to attend ISIRV educational events.

The Society has a number of dedicated funds at its disposal from which it offers grants to members for specific purposes. The Society also awards a range of prizes in recognition of outstanding contributions and achievements in the respiratory virus field.

Early Career Researchers (ECRs) & students

Early Career Researchers/Members are defined as individuals who have a maximum of 8 years (whole-time equivalent) of professional experience following the completion of their highest academic degree (e.g., PhD, MD, Master of Public Health) or equivalent.

Schools of respiratory viruses

Schools of Respiratory Viruses are held all over the world. They are educational events aimed at graduate students and early career scientists who are starting, or in the early stages of their career.

Bursaries, scholarships and travel grants

ISRV offers bursaries, scholarships and travel grants to develop and support a global network respiratory virus scientists. We offer funding to support Early Career Researchers (ECRs) from every region of the world.
